Transaction 37c110e2aad7bbb3f625f1366af26712941114837a782abd51150349e569a6ab

1 Input
1 Outputs
  • 37c110e2aad7bbb3f625f1366af26712941114837a782abd51150349e569a6ab:0
  • value  989492
    address  38dLMcE6oaK848B85X6xKy8jZJ7XCGJjfs